Longitudinal Changes in Swiss Adolescent's Mental Health Outcomes from before and during the COVID-19 Pandemic.

Abstract

This study aimed to explore changes in mental health outcomes (depression, anxiety, home, and school stress) from before the first COVID-19 wave (autumn 2019) to the later stages of the same wave (autumn 2020) in a sample of
